Lestat
28-01-2011, 13:37
I don't think it has deteriorated, in fact parts of it are now much nicer than those days you reminisce about. There is a brand spanking new hi-tech school with new floodlit football pitches, The roads with old housing have been demolished leaving open space, there are new businesses i.e Tesco, the hospitals had a total re-vamp.

Crabtree was always abit of a dive and it was only interesting because we were kids back then. We didn't appreciate the plants wildlife & fungi as much.

Barnsley Road houses and those in along Firth Park Road have all been given a clean up and the mosque & church are still attracting members of both faiths to use them.

The only downside is the parking problems at Owler Lane shops and the gangs of illegal immigrants roaming the lower end / Page Hall area. There are plenty worse places to point the finger at in Sheffield.
